Eight children die in Louisiana attack

A shooting incident in Louisiana has left eight children dead, making it the deadliest in the US for over two years. Officers stated the domestic disturbance happened across at least three sites on Sunday morning, with ten people shot in total. The individuals involved were aged one to fourteen; officers killed the suspect after a pursuit.
